Evaluating Potential Risk of Choking by Laryngeal Ultrasound in Patients With Acute Stroke

Sponsor: National Taiwan University Hospital

View on ClinicalTrials.gov

Summary

The investigators evaluate the vocal cord movement in patients with acute stroke by ultrasound. The occurrence of choking or aspiration pneumonia will be collected in one year after the index stroke.
